一種信號(hào)發(fā)生器穩(wěn)幅環(huán)路的設(shè)計(jì)與實(shí)現(xiàn)
Design and Implementation of a Signal Generator Amplitude Stabilization Loop
本文引用地址:http://www.ex-cimer.com/article/201903/399032.htm鐵奎 田元瑣
(中國(guó)電子科技集團(tuán)公司第四十一研究所 安徽 蚌埠233010)
摘要:針對(duì)信號(hào)發(fā)生器中功率控制的需求,采用理論推導(dǎo)的方法得到閉環(huán)穩(wěn)幅環(huán)路的理論依據(jù)并設(shè)計(jì)了閉環(huán)穩(wěn)幅環(huán)路的電路原理,逐一實(shí)現(xiàn)檢波器的功率-電壓轉(zhuǎn)換,環(huán)路數(shù)字化運(yùn)算的誤差積分和環(huán)路狀態(tài)控制,功準(zhǔn)確度和頻率響應(yīng)的校準(zhǔn),最后通過(guò)實(shí)際測(cè)量驗(yàn)證了設(shè)計(jì)的有效性。
關(guān)鍵詞:穩(wěn)幅環(huán)路;開(kāi)閉環(huán);檢波器;校準(zhǔn)
中圖分類號(hào):TN911.72 文獻(xiàn)標(biāo)識(shí)碼:B
基金名稱:國(guó)家科技重大專項(xiàng)2018ZX03001026
1 引言
信號(hào)發(fā)生裝置中功率控制必不可少,一般情況下功率大小的輸出是通過(guò)小步進(jìn)電調(diào)衰減器與大步進(jìn)程控衰減器結(jié)合使用來(lái)實(shí)現(xiàn)功率的大動(dòng)態(tài)范圍調(diào)整。功率控制除了調(diào)整輸出信號(hào)功率大小之外,還有保持信號(hào)輸出功率穩(wěn)定度的需求,因此在小步進(jìn)電調(diào)衰減器的控制過(guò)程中根據(jù)是否將輸出功率反饋給電壓調(diào)整電路分為開(kāi)環(huán)與閉環(huán),大多數(shù)的信號(hào)源都具備閉環(huán)穩(wěn)幅功能,從而保證信號(hào)的輸出功率不會(huì)因輸入功率的微小變化或有源器件增益隨工作溫度變化造成的偏差而受到較大影響。
2 閉環(huán)穩(wěn)幅環(huán)路的原理
閉環(huán)穩(wěn)幅具備穩(wěn)定輸出功率的作用,其控制電調(diào)衰減器的衰減量一定與輸出端檢測(cè)的功率大小成正相關(guān)性,也就是輸出端耦合的功率越大,其通過(guò)閉環(huán)穩(wěn)幅環(huán)路調(diào)整電調(diào)衰減器的衰減量越大,從而使得輸出功率減小,是一個(gè)負(fù)反饋的過(guò)程。其電路原理如圖1所示。
輸出信號(hào)經(jīng)過(guò)定向耦合、檢波后得到電壓輸出信號(hào)經(jīng)過(guò)定向耦合、檢波后得到電壓Vdfalse,檢波電壓與參考電壓比較后得到的差值再進(jìn)行積分得到Vi false
積分電壓與參考電壓求和后得到電調(diào)衰減器的控制電壓Vc false
假設(shè)檢波功率Poutfalse越大,檢波電壓Vdfalse越大;Vcfalse越大,電調(diào)衰減器的衰減越大,即信號(hào)輸出功率Poutfalse越小。此時(shí)若有某種不可控因素導(dǎo)致信號(hào)輸出功率Poutfalse變大,那么Vdfalse變大,△V=Vd-Vreffalse也變大導(dǎo)致Vc false變大,從而使得Poutfalse變小,這樣穩(wěn)幅環(huán)路便可以達(dá)到某種動(dòng)態(tài)平衡。從上述過(guò)程可以看出只要△Vfalse不為零,環(huán)路就一直在調(diào)整,直到△Vfalse趨于零為止,也就是Vdfalse無(wú)限趨近于Vreffalse。只要Vreffalse不變,任何其他原因?qū)е螺敵龉β首兓瘡亩?em>Vdfalse產(chǎn)生變化的過(guò)程,只要在環(huán)路調(diào)整范圍之內(nèi),都可通過(guò)動(dòng)態(tài)調(diào)整最終平衡到Vdfalse無(wú)限趨近于Vreffalse的狀態(tài),即Vdfalse幾乎保持不變,同樣輸出功率Poutfalse也幾乎保持不變。
3 閉環(huán)穩(wěn)幅環(huán)路的設(shè)計(jì)
3.1 穩(wěn)幅環(huán)路原理設(shè)計(jì)
為了便于環(huán)路的控制,我們?cè)O(shè)計(jì)采用了數(shù)字穩(wěn)幅環(huán)路,主要是將環(huán)路積分、參考電壓設(shè)置和環(huán)路工作狀態(tài)由數(shù)字電路實(shí)現(xiàn)。它的優(yōu)點(diǎn)在于可以對(duì)環(huán)路的開(kāi)閉環(huán)狀態(tài)及取樣保持根據(jù)時(shí)間要求動(dòng)態(tài)調(diào)整,尤其對(duì)于通信類的脈沖信號(hào)可以讓開(kāi)閉環(huán)狀態(tài)與時(shí)隙同步,這樣就避免了脈沖信號(hào)造成環(huán)路失鎖,其電路設(shè)計(jì)如圖2。輸出功率通過(guò)定向耦合器進(jìn)入檢波電路得到檢波電壓,經(jīng)過(guò)AD轉(zhuǎn)換數(shù)字化后導(dǎo)入FPGA進(jìn)行誤差比較、積分及與參考電壓的求和計(jì)算得到電壓控制字,最后經(jīng)過(guò)DA轉(zhuǎn)換成模擬電壓控制電調(diào)衰減器的衰減程度。
3.2 檢波電路的設(shè)計(jì)
在實(shí)際電路的設(shè)計(jì)過(guò)程中,檢波器采用AD8318對(duì)數(shù)檢波器,其主要電路設(shè)計(jì)如圖3所示。其工作頻率范圍1MHz~8GHz;準(zhǔn)確度±1dB(55dB范圍);溫度穩(wěn)定性±0.5dB;對(duì)數(shù)斜坡-25mV/dB;脈沖響應(yīng)時(shí)間10/12ns;集成溫度探頭2mV/K;5V@68mA;封裝LFCSP4mm×4mm;噪聲功率-68dBm;最佳線性范圍-50~-10dBm;芯片工作在控制模式時(shí),配置如下。
ENBL:高使能,低休眠;
INHI、INLO:1MHz~8GHz建議耦合電容0402型1nF,外跨接52.3Ω匹配電阻;
VOUT:內(nèi)部PNP射極跟隨輸出
VSET:設(shè)置參考電壓;
TADJ:輸出電壓溫度補(bǔ)償,常態(tài)配接500Ω對(duì)地電阻,隨頻率改變;
TEMP:溫度傳感器輸出2mV/℃,27℃時(shí)為600mV;
CFLT:對(duì)地連接參考電容,對(duì)環(huán)路不平衡時(shí)的誤差積分;
檢波器輸出電壓與檢波功率、頻率對(duì)應(yīng)關(guān)系如表1。
3.3 FPGA的設(shè)計(jì)
FPGA內(nèi)部電路設(shè)計(jì)如圖4所示。
實(shí)際電路設(shè)計(jì)過(guò)程中,參考電壓Vreffalse首先要根據(jù)檢波的頻率不同疊加一個(gè)頻響補(bǔ)償電壓Vffalse(不同的頻率在同一功率下檢波電壓不同),檢波電壓Vdfalse與補(bǔ)償電壓Vffalse求和后得到預(yù)置功率電壓Vpfalse,并在積分電壓輸出前增加了環(huán)路狀態(tài)控制電路。
在閉環(huán)狀態(tài)下,電調(diào)衰減器控制電壓Vcfalse,由Vreffalse、Vffalse和Vi false共同作用,即
在開(kāi)環(huán)狀態(tài)下,電調(diào)衰減器控制電壓Vcfalse由Vreffalse和Vffalse共同作用,即
在取樣保持狀態(tài)下,電調(diào)衰減器控制電壓,由Vreffalse、Vffalse和Vi false的上一次的輸出結(jié)果共同作用,此時(shí)檢波電壓Vdfalse不再參與反饋,積分電路停止工作,保持上一次的電壓輸出結(jié)果不變,即
穩(wěn)幅環(huán)路FPGA設(shè)計(jì)核心代碼如下:
process(CLK200M_0)
begin
if CLK200M_0’event and CLK200M_0=’1’
then
acc_en_1<=adc_epy;
acc_en<=acc_en_1;
end if;
end process;
process(CLK200M_0)
begin
if CLK200M_0’event and CLK200M_0=’1’
then
ad_acc_start_1 <= ad_acc_start;
ad_acc_start_2 <= ad_acc_start_1;
end if;
end process;
ad_acc_start_3 <= (not ad_acc_start_2) and ad_
acc_start_1;
ad_acc_start_4 <= (not ad_acc_start_1) and ad_
acc_start_2;
process(CLK200M_0)
begin
if CLK200M_0’event and CLK200M_0=’1’
then
if cw_EN = ‘0’ then
cw_win_stage<=’0’;
loop_en <= ‘0’;
loop_counter <= x”000”;
else
if loop_switch = ‘0’ then
loop_en <= ‘1’;
else
if ad_acc_start_3 = ‘1’ then
loop_en <= ‘1’;
loop_counter <= x”000”;
else
if qt_en_12 = ‘1’ then
if loop_counter = x”1ff” then ---x”190” then
loop_en <= ‘0’;
loop_counter <= loop_counter;
else
loop_counter <= loop_counter + ‘1’;
end if;
else
loop_en <= loop_en;
loop_counter <= loop_counter;
end if;
end if;
end if;
if ad_acc_start_3 =’1’ then
cw_win_stage<=’1’;
elsif ad_acc_start_4 =’1’ then
cw_win_stage<=’0’;
else
cw_win_stage<=cw_win_stage;
end if;
end if;
end if;
end process;
3.4 功率準(zhǔn)確度的校準(zhǔn)
功率校準(zhǔn)的目的就是建立參考電壓與輸出功率之間的映射表,通過(guò)預(yù)期輸出功率可以快速查到對(duì)應(yīng)的參考電壓設(shè)置。校準(zhǔn)是在穩(wěn)幅環(huán)路開(kāi)環(huán)狀態(tài)下進(jìn)行,其過(guò)程如下:對(duì)參考電壓控制字從小到大開(kāi)始遍歷設(shè)置,然后會(huì)得到相對(duì)應(yīng)的輸出功率,保存電壓控制字,最后得到一個(gè)功率校準(zhǔn)表,也就是參考電壓與實(shí)際功率輸出的映射關(guān)系。在最大與最小輸出功率之間沒(méi)有得到相應(yīng)的功率控制字時(shí),可通過(guò)線性擬合的方法計(jì)算得到。因此功率輸出準(zhǔn)確度與映射表格容量有關(guān),映射關(guān)系越精細(xì),功率控制越準(zhǔn)確。
3.5 頻率響應(yīng)的校準(zhǔn)
由于射頻通道的頻響特性會(huì)造成同樣的信號(hào)由于頻率不同而通道增益不同,因此需要對(duì)輸出同樣功率的信號(hào),由于通道增益不同帶來(lái)的電調(diào)衰減器衰減差別進(jìn)行校準(zhǔn),即針對(duì)同樣輸出功率由于頻率不同,調(diào)整控制電壓,用不同的電調(diào)衰減器衰減來(lái)補(bǔ)償通道頻響,校準(zhǔn)過(guò)程如下:將信號(hào)輸出功率設(shè)定為某一固定值,在信號(hào)輸出頻率范圍內(nèi)以固定頻率步進(jìn)遍歷輸出,測(cè)量實(shí)際輸出信號(hào)的功率大小,實(shí)際輸出與目標(biāo)輸出功率的差值即為需要補(bǔ)償?shù)念l響功率。校準(zhǔn)完成后可得到一張信號(hào)輸出頻率與需要補(bǔ)償功率的映射關(guān)系表。在最小與最大輸出頻率之間,沒(méi)有遍歷到的頻率點(diǎn),可通過(guò)線性擬合的方法得到。同樣射頻通道頻響性能與頻響校準(zhǔn)映射表的容量有關(guān),頻率遍歷步進(jìn)越小、映射表格越大,射頻通道頻響特性越好。
4 測(cè)試結(jié)果
圖5-7為閉環(huán)穩(wěn)幅頻率設(shè)置為2GHz,功率分別設(shè)置為10dBm、0dBm、-10dBm時(shí)實(shí)測(cè)值,可以看出目標(biāo)輸出功率與實(shí)測(cè)功率誤差極小。
圖8-10為閉環(huán)穩(wěn)幅時(shí)功率設(shè)置為5 dBm,頻率分別設(shè)置為1GHz、1.5GHz、2GHz時(shí)實(shí)測(cè)的功率值,可以看出功率隨頻率變化波動(dòng)極小。
5 結(jié)束語(yǔ)
穩(wěn)幅環(huán)路狀態(tài)有閉環(huán)、開(kāi)環(huán)與保持三種狀態(tài),一般根據(jù)實(shí)際工作條件進(jìn)行選擇。閉環(huán)穩(wěn)幅環(huán)路功率穩(wěn)定性最好,但由于是負(fù)反饋電路,若有輸入信號(hào)帶有脈沖調(diào)制,有可能導(dǎo)致環(huán)路失鎖,此時(shí)環(huán)路應(yīng)切換為保持或開(kāi)環(huán)狀態(tài);若穩(wěn)幅閉環(huán)中要加入調(diào)幅信號(hào),那么環(huán)路帶寬要隨著調(diào)制頻率的大小而調(diào)整。在實(shí)際電路中,一般連續(xù)波或模擬調(diào)制會(huì)在閉環(huán)狀態(tài);普通數(shù)字調(diào)制,碼元速率較小時(shí)需開(kāi)環(huán)或保持,碼元速率較大時(shí)可以閉環(huán)但可能會(huì)影響信號(hào)質(zhì)量;通信信號(hào)如LTE、WCDMA等則需要穩(wěn)幅環(huán)路在開(kāi)環(huán)或保持狀態(tài)。
參考文獻(xiàn):
[1]劉長(zhǎng)文,馮克明.寬頻帶信號(hào)源穩(wěn)幅環(huán)路設(shè)計(jì)[J].宇航計(jì)測(cè)技術(shù),2013,26(5):12-15.
[2]許傳忠,楊春濤等.脈沖信號(hào)穩(wěn)幅方法研究[J].宇航計(jì)測(cè)技術(shù),2012,25(1):9-13.
[3]李卓明.寬帶大動(dòng)態(tài)范圍自動(dòng)電平控制技術(shù)研究[J].電子測(cè)量技術(shù),2012,33(5):7-9.
[4]劉彥庭.超寬帶大動(dòng)態(tài)范圍自動(dòng)電平控制技術(shù)的研究[D].電子科技大學(xué)學(xué)報(bào),2016,9(4):5-11.
[5]吳膺才.短波發(fā)射機(jī)射頻模塊數(shù)字化設(shè)計(jì)[J].信息通信,2017,127:75-77.
[6]金紹春,鮑景富等.一種矢量信號(hào)發(fā)生器設(shè)計(jì)與實(shí)現(xiàn)[J].電子產(chǎn)品世界,2012,19(285):44-47.
[7]徐文虎,蔣政波等.便攜式TDD-LTE矢量信號(hào)發(fā)生器的研制[J].電子測(cè)量與儀器學(xué)報(bào),2011,25(6):546-552.
[8]吳迎笑,楊震等.基于頻譜感知的認(rèn)知無(wú)線電機(jī)會(huì)功率控制算法[J].儀器儀表學(xué)報(bào),2010,31(6):1235-1240.
[9]王海燕等.LTE終端射頻測(cè)試技術(shù)分析[J].電信網(wǎng)技術(shù),2011(8):81-84.
作者簡(jiǎn)介
鐵奎:1981年生,男,安徽淮南,本科,高級(jí)工程師,主要研究方向?yàn)橐苿?dòng)通信測(cè)試技術(shù)。
田元瑣:1983年生,男,安徽淮南,碩士研究生,高級(jí)工程師,主要研究方向?yàn)閿?shù)字中頻處理。
本文來(lái)源于科技期刊《電子產(chǎn)品世界》2019年第4期第36頁(yè),歡迎您寫論文時(shí)引用,并注明出處
評(píng)論